Given number is 53256
The factor tree of 53256 is as follows:
| 53256 | |||||||||||
| 2 | 26628 | ||||||||||
| 2 | 13314 | ||||||||||
| 2 | 6657 | ||||||||||
| 3 | 2219 | ||||||||||
| 7 | 317 | ||||||||||
53256 = 2 x 26628
26628 = 2 x 13314
13314 = 2 x 6657
6657 = 3 x 2219
2219 = 7 x 317
